Output 158632fcfe5bb75db3d01b3abcb55e90aabe583d2786263f55ea559a36c60e35:1

value
3252560
script pubkey
OP_0 OP_PUSHBYTES_20 ac8623b52ecc3658fb2907b5a1965233b2b77eb0
address
ltc1q4jrz8dfwesm937efq766r9jjxwetwl4stc4ynl
transaction
158632fcfe5bb75db3d01b3abcb55e90aabe583d2786263f55ea559a36c60e35
spent
true